Abstract

Invertebrates make up 95% of the species on this planet, and yet their importance is constantly overlooked. From shellac to birth control hormones, invertebrates are used in many unexpected places.

To encourage a life-long interest in and respect of invertebrates, this project aims to create a website which will teach primary aged children about the different sorts of invertebrates which we encounter in everyday life and the ways in which they change the world around them.

By using David Kolb's Theory of Experiential Learning to teach children more effectively, Pomorum.co.uk aims to be educational and fun, whilst also teaching them to see invertebrates in a new light. Including elements from the UK national curriculum brings Pomorum more relevance in schools, and hopefully turn it into a website which can be used in classrooms around the country.
